Christian Eriksen scored with his first touch on his international comeback but the Netherlands held on for the win.

Perfect return

The Danish footballer has said he is proud that he can still compete at a high level despite suffering a cardiac arrest at Euro 2020 last summer, which sidelined him for an extended period. Christian returned to Denmark on Saturday, scoring with his first touch less than two minutes after coming on as a substitute, creating numerous other chances in the process. Describing the return as perfect, the Brentford playmaker indicated he feels comfortable back with his international teammates and ready to help out at the 2022 World Cup.

 

What did Christian Eriksen say?

Danish footballer Christian Eriksen said he was pleased to show that he can still play. According to Eriksen, he has the feeling that he has never been away from the team. It was a little emotional to return to the national team, but he hardly missed any games in the last 10 years, so he is like part of the family. Christian Eriksen added that he felt very welcome by the Dutch fans. Christian has been here before for Ajax for many years, so of course they know him, but it was a very heart warming experience for sure.

The midfielder was happy that the ball came to him and of course it was a great finish. Starting a return to international football this way was the perfect way. Christian Eriksen is looking forward to playing at the World Cup in Qatar, but there are many games between them and he is focused on them.

Denmark boss Kasper Hjulmand said it was a pleasure to see the popular playmaker back on the serve and revealed what he said to the midfielder before sending him into the fray. “I said, ‘Enjoy yourself and welcome back,'” said the head coach of Denmark.
